Families seek help after fire destroys homes in Manson orchard
On April 29, a fire ravaged the homes of the Torres and Duarte families in Manson, Washington, with the Duarte family experiencing the most destruction. The fire reportedly began behind a neighbor's house, leading to a total loss of their trailer and personal belongings. Kimberly Duarte highlighted her family's struggle on their GoFundMe page, emphasizing their need for assistance after losing all necessities. The Torres family, consisting of eight children, is temporarily living in an RV while they seek long-term housing solutions. Both families have launched GoFundMe campaigns to help replace essential items and recover from this devastating loss.
As of Wednesday, the fundraisers are active and receiving donations from the community. Fortunately, there have been no reported injuries, and local authorities continue to investigate the fire's cause.
